Great points, bat69; thanks for sharing that. It's a great lesson on a concept the military guys here are surely familiar with: 1st line - 2nd line - 3rd line gear.
1st line gear is always on your person, 2nd line gear is sometimes on your person and 3rd line gear is for longer term sustainment. Adapt as needed to your situation.
For those of you working in various degrees of non-permissive environments (NPEs) another stealth option is Galco's
Cop Ankle Safe. I was at an evening function last week where the dress code was tucked-in shirt but no jacket. I could not have a knife's pocket clip showing or my dangling CPR pouch on my belt. The ankle safe worked like a charm.
